Overview

The Clayton Guest House Stratford-upon-Avon offers easy access to Holy Trinity Church, which is situated a mere 6 minutes' walk away. The 3-star hotel provides private car parking for additional cost nearby.

Location

The guest house is 4.4 km from Stratford Armouries Museum and 2.3 km from The Welcombe Spa. Anne Hathaway's Cottage Manor House is also located just a minute's drive from the accommodation. This budget hotel offers quick access to The MAD Museum, situated merely 650 metres away.

The Clayton Guest House is around a 5-minute walk from Broad Walk bus stop and around a 15-minute walk from Stratford-upon-Avon train station in Stratford-upon-Avon.

Rooms

The property has 6 rooms with a seating area and a dining area. A flat-screen TV with satellite channels along with coffee/tea making equipment are provided. Bathrooms inlude a separate toilet and a shower, and such fine comforts as hairdryers and towels.
